ANCHORAGE — Wasilla’s brutal weekend ended with a third loss in the loaded Alaska Airlines Classic at West Anchorage on Saturday.
Nome edged Wasilla 49-45 in the tournament’s seventh-place game. Cass Mattheis scored a game-high 22 points for the Nanooks, who notched a 17-11 second-quarter run.
Alex Baham led the Warriors with 15 points in the loss. He was 4 of 9 from behind the arc.
Cash McGregor added 10 points and nine rebounds, and Cameron Brown chipped in nine points.
ACS, the 2013 3A state runner-up, scored a 74-45 win over the Warriors on Friday. Brown led the Warriors with 15 points. McGregor chipped in 11.
The Warriors’ long weekend started with a loss to the Wasatch Academy Tigers, a prep school from Utah.
